Abstract

A restraint belt presenter assembly includes a restraint belt engaging member that is selectively driven by a track drive mechanism to catch and pull a restraint belt from its unused position to a presentation position for grasping by a vehicle occupant. In one embodiment, the restraint belt engaging member includes a selectively upwardly moving arm having a finger assembly with an offset rotary action for moving the finger assembly into an actuating position. In a second embodiment, the restraint belt engaging member is connected to a hinge member that pivots the restraint belt engaging member into an actuating position.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is:  
     
         1 . A restraint belt presenter assembly for bringing a restraint belt forward comprising: 
 a restraint belt engaging member having a selectively movable upper arm, a lower arm and a finger assembly mounted on said upper arm;    a pivot member for rotationally pivoting said finger assembly toward an actuated position; and    a track drive mechanism positioned adjacent a vehicle seat for selectively driving said restraint belt engaging member from a starting position to a presentation position.    
     
     
         2 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 1   , wherein said lower arm further includes a slot that receives said upper arm.  
     
     
         3 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 2   , wherein said lower arm further includes a screw member fixedly secured to a rotatable cog.  
     
     
         4 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 3   , wherein a bottom portion of said upper arm is operatively connected to said screw member.  
     
     
         5 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 4   , further including a toothed track member positioned alongside the vehicle seat, wherein said rotatable cog meshes with said toothed track member as said restraint belt moves from said starting position to said presentation position, thereby turning said screw member in a first predetermined direction so as to move upper arm upwardly.  
     
     
         6 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 1   , wherein said finger assembly is contained in a cap housing positioned on a top portion of said selectively movable upper arm, said cap housing having a slot from which a selectively retractable presenting finger protrudes.  
     
     
         7 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 1   , wherein said pivot member is rotatably mounted on a base member.  
     
     
         8 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 7   , wherein said pivot member includes corresponding walls that cooperate to define a channel therebetween that receives a mounting member connected to an end portion of said presenting finger.  
     
     
         9 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 8   , wherein said mounting member is pivotally connected to said pivot member.  
     
     
         10 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 8   , wherein said mounting member further includes a positioning lug that cooperates with a recess formed in said base member.  
     
     
         11 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 10   , further including a first spring for biasing said positioning lug in a first predetermined position.  
     
     
         12 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 11   , further including a second spring for biasing said pivot member in a second predetermined position.  
     
     
         13 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 1   , wherein said drive mechanism includes a carriage moved along a track by a belt driven by a motor.  
     
     
         14 . A restraint belt presenter assembly for bringing a restraint belt forward comprising: 
 a restraint belt engaging member having a selectively movable upper arm that has a bottom portion connected to a screw member positioned in a lower arm and a finger assembly mounted on said upper arm;    a rotatable cog fixedly secured to said screw member;    a pivot member for rotationally pivoting said finger assembly toward an actuated position;    a track drive mechanism positioned adjacent a vehicle seat for selectively driving said restraint belt engaging member from a starting position to a presentation position; and    a toothed track member positioned alongside the vehicle seat, wherein said rotatable cog meshes with said toothed track member as said restraint belt moves from said starting position to said presentation position, thereby turning said screw member in a first predetermined direction so as to move upper arm upwardly.    
     
     
         15 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 14   , wherein said finger assembly is contained in a cap housing positioned on a top portion of said selectively movable upper arm, said cap housing having a slot from which a selectively retractable presenting finger protrudes.  
     
     
         16 . The restraint belt presenter assembly of    claim 15   , wherein said pivot member includes corresponding walls that cooperate to define a channel therebetween that receives a mounting member pivotally connected to an end portion of said presenting finger, wherein said mounting member further includes a positioning lug that cooperates with a recess formed in said base member, wherein said a first spring operates to bias said positioning lug in a first predetermined position and a second spring operates to bias said pivot member in a second predetermined position.  
     
     
         17 . A restraint belt presenter assembly for bringing a restraint belt forward comprising: 
 a selectively movable carriage carrying a restraint belt engaging member;    a mounting member positioned on said carriage;    a hinge member connected to said mounting member for pivotal movement about said mounting member; and    a track drive mechanism positioned adjacent a vehicle seat for selectively driving said carriage carrying said restraint belt engaging member from a starting position to a presentation position.    
     
     
         18 . The restraint belt presenting member of    claim 17   , wherein said hinge member includes a first pair of ears that cooperate to form a channel therebetween, said mounting member being positioned in said channel and said hinge being secured to said mounting member for pivotal movement about said mounting member.  
     
     
         19 . The restraint belt presenting member of    claim 18   , wherein said hinge member includes a second pair of ears that cooperate to form a second channel therebetween, said second channel receiving said restraint belt engaging member therein, wherein said restraint belt engaging member is mounted to said hinge member for pivotal movement.  
     
     
         20 . The restraint belt presenting member of    claim 19   , wherein said second channel further includes a stop member positioned between said second pair of ears to limit the pivotal movement of said restraint belt engaging member.  
     
     
         21 . The restraint belt presenting member of    claim 17   , further including a projecting feature for engaging said restraint belt engaging member and assisting in moving said restraint belt engaging member to the actuated position.
